I've been gassing for a strat type guitar lately. Probably alder body, maple neck, maple board, with a Wilk or vintage trem, all of which seems to be a recipe for brightness. My guitar shop guy tells me it will also slightly scoop the mids. This one will be mostly for leads for overdriven rock, hard rock, and late 70's-early 80's metal. The guitar will mostly go through amps similar to modified Marshall master volume circuits. I'm really a humbucker guy rather than a single coil guy, though I do sometimes like the strat bridge/middle notch sound.
I'm flexible on the pickup configuration because pickguards are relatively cheap. Initially I was thinking HH a la Priest, although HSS is much more common and it looks like the singles can be wired in series for a humbucker-esque sound, as can an SSS configuration with or w/o a single sized humbucker.
My top picks right now are the JB, the Custom, the Custom 5, and the Distortion. Several people suggested the JB. The guitar shop guy also suggested the JB and mentioned the JB, jr. Any thoughts about how well those pickups would fit the bill? How well to they do in parallel in notch positions (a secondary consideration, but hey best to find out ahead of time)? Any others I should look at?
